Cooking instructions

Instructions for 2 [for 3] [for 4] portion recipe.

1

Before you begin...

This recipe takes around 5-10 min to prep, so get your casserole dish and all your ingredients ready, then wash your fruit and veg

Note: Make sure your dish is oven-proof and safe to use on the hob. Don't have one? Start cooking in a large, wide-based pan then transfer to an oven-proof dish

Step 1
2

Now, let's get started!

Preheat the oven to 220°C/ 200°C (fan)/ gas 7 and boil a kettle

Heat a large, wide-based, hob-safe oven-proof casserole dish with a drizzle of vegetable oil over a medium-high heat

Once hot, add your diced beef and bacon lardons to the dish with 1 tbsp [1 1/2 tbsp] [2 tbsp] flour and a generous grind of black pepper and cook for 2 min or until lightly browned

Step 2
3

Meanwhile, slice your potatoes (skins on) into discs

Crush your garlic open by squashing with the side of a knife and remove the skin

Peel and chop your shallot[s] in half

Top, tail and chop your carrot[s] into rounds

Step 3
4

Add the crushed garlic, chopped shallot and carrot rounds to the dish

Add in your beef stock mix with your tomato paste, Henderson's Relish and 350ml [525ml] [700ml] boiled water, then bring to the boil over a high heat – this is your beef & bacon mix

Step 4
5

Once boiling, carefully arrange the potato discs over the top of the beef & bacon mix

Season with a grind of black pepper, dot with a couple of small knobs of butter, cover with a lid and put the dish in the oven for an initial 15 min

After 15 min, remove the lid, then return the dish to the oven for 45 min further or until the potatoes are golden and the meat is tender and cooked through – this is your one pot beef & bacon hotpot

Step 6
7

When the hotpot has 15 min left, cut 1 piece of tin foil approx. the size of an A4 sheet of paper and add to a baking tray

Trim, then add your green beans and Tenderstem broccoli to the middle with a small knob of butter

Tip: Cooking for 3 or more? Make 2 separate parcels!

Scrunch the edges of the foil around the veg to form a sealed parcel[s], then put the tray in the oven for 15 min or until tender – these are your roasted greens

Step 7
8

Serve the one pot beef & bacon hotpot with the roasted greens to the side
